Grey-headed Goshawk
The Grey-headed Goshawk (<em>Accipiter poliocephalus</em>) is a raptor of the family Accipitridae (Hawks, Eagles & Kites), occurring in the forested islands of the southwestern Pacific. It is a forest-specialist, inhabiting lowland and montane forest environments where it is believed to hunt birds and small vertebrates through the canopy. Detailed plumage and behavioral descriptions of this species are limited in the available literature, though its common name reflects a distinctive grey head coloration that distinguishes it within its range. 非洲隼雕
The African Hawk-eagle weighs about 1.45kg and inhabits woodland and forest across sub-Saharan Africa. It is a bold and powerful hunter of medium-sized birds and mammals.
